A letter calling Kate and Layton back to Alabama leads to shocking truths, uncovered secrets, family drama, and a love story about the enduring power of hope.A letter arrives for Kate and Layton Cummins, summoning them back to their small hometown in Alabama for the reading of Amanda O'Hara's will. Once beloved as the town librarian, Amanda was a pillar for Cumminsville, and her death stirs up more than just memories. Shocking events in New York City and at the family estate down south pull the couple into a whirlwind of secrets that threaten their lives, their careers, and their entire family.As they navigate these revelations, they find themselves grappling with profound questions about their beliefs, their past decisions, and the nature of what's right. At the heart of the storm is a story about loss and redemption, where past and present collide with powerful emotional stakes.Ultimately a story about loss and redemption, The Romance Section is a bold, unflinching exploration of contemporary issues, including abortion, family values, and societal divisions. But despite its heavy themes, the tone of the book is one of optimism and hope, showing the enduring power of love and human resilience.With shades of Bridges of Madison County and Sweet Home Alabama, The Romance Section is spicy, saucy, and incredibly easy to read.
